Information for this tour was contributed by John Stewart. The Aquarius was built in 1972-73 by Trans Texas Theatres as their third theatre in Austin. All 4 auditoriums featured curtains in front of the screen with auditoriums 1, 2, & 4 having traditional travelers in them and auditorium 3 had waterfalls. Each theatre had it own color scheme as well. Now the building serves as a Small Mercado of sorts with a Mexican food restaurant in what was auditorium 4.
